Area Requirements
Cockatiels need plenty of room to fly and check out. A well-sized cage is important, as it ought to enable comfortable movement.

Acquiring a cockatiel is just the beginning of the expenses. Here's a breakdown of the expenses you must expect:
1. Initial Acquisition Cost
The price of a cockatiel can vary extensively based upon aspects like age, color anomaly, and source:
Average price range: ₤ 100 - ₤ 300Colors like lutino or pied might cost more.2. Cage and Accessories
Setup costs can vary depending upon the quality of the cage and accessories:
Cage: ₤ 100 - ₤ 300Perches: ₤ 10 - ₤ 30Toys: ₤ 5 - ₤ 20 eachFood and Water Bowls: ₤ 5 - ₤ 153. Ongoing Care Costs

Can I keep a cockatiel alone?
Yes, cockatiels can adapt to living alone, however they are social animals. If possible, consider getting a 2nd cockatiel for friendship.
2. Are cockatiels helpful for beginners?
Absolutely! Their friendly nature and fairly simple care make them an exceptional choice for first-time bird owners.
3. Do cockatiels require a great deal of attention?
Cockatiels flourish on social interaction and needs to be managed frequently to develop a strong bond with their owners.
4. How do I train my cockatiel?
Begin training with simple commands and favorable reinforcement, such as treats and praise. Consistency is crucial.
5. What is the finest diet for a cockatiel?
A balanced diet should include top quality pellets, fresh fruits, and veggies, along with occasional seeds as treats.
